zeus::IZVariant Member List

This is the complete list of members for zeus::IZVariant, including all inherited members.
addRef() const =0zeus::IZUnknown [pure virtual]
askForInterface(const InterfaceID &rInterfaceID, IZUnknown *&rpIface)=0zeus::IZUnknown [pure virtual]
assign(const IZVariant &rInpar)=0zeus::IZVariant [pure virtual]
compareTo(const IZVariant &rInpar) const =0zeus::IZVariant [pure virtual]
equals(const IZVariant &rInpar) const =0zeus::IZVariant [pure virtual]
etByteArray enum valuezeus::IZVariant
etEmpty enum valuezeus::IZVariant
etFloat32 enum valuezeus::IZVariant
etFloat64 enum valuezeus::IZVariant
etInt16 enum valuezeus::IZVariant
etInt32 enum valuezeus::IZVariant
etInt64 enum valuezeus::IZVariant
etInt8 enum valuezeus::IZVariant
etObject enum valuezeus::IZVariant
etObjectList enum valuezeus::IZVariant
etString enum valuezeus::IZVariant
etUint16 enum valuezeus::IZVariant
etUint32 enum valuezeus::IZVariant
etUint64 enum valuezeus::IZVariant
etUint8 enum valuezeus::IZVariant
EZVariantType enum namezeus::IZVariant
getByteArray(IByteArray &raRet) const =0zeus::IZVariant [pure virtual]
getCastedObject(const InterfaceID &rIfaceID, IZUnknown *&rpRet) const =0zeus::IZVariant [pure virtual]
getFloat32(Float32 &rf32Ret) const =0zeus::IZVariant [pure virtual]
getFloat64(Float64 &rf64Ret) const =0zeus::IZVariant [pure virtual]
getInt16(Int16 &ri16Ret) const =0zeus::IZVariant [pure virtual]
getInt32(Int32 &ri32Ret) const =0zeus::IZVariant [pure virtual]
getInt64(Int64 &ri64Ret) const =0zeus::IZVariant [pure virtual]
getInt8(Int8 &ri8Ret) const =0zeus::IZVariant [pure virtual]
getObject(ISerializable *&rpRet) const =0zeus::IZVariant [pure virtual]
getObjectID() const =0zeus::ISerializable [pure virtual]
getObjectList(ISerializableList &rRet) const =0zeus::IZVariant [pure virtual]
getRetval(Retval &rretRet) const =0zeus::IZVariant [pure virtual]
getString(IString &rstrRet) const =0zeus::IZVariant [pure virtual]
getTimeval(Timeval &rtmRet) const =0zeus::IZVariant [pure virtual]
getType() const =0zeus::IZVariant [pure virtual]
getUint16(Uint16 &rui16Ret) const =0zeus::IZVariant [pure virtual]
getUint32(Uint32 &rui32Ret) const =0zeus::IZVariant [pure virtual]
getUint64(Uint64 &rui64Ret) const =0zeus::IZVariant [pure virtual]
getUint8(Uint8 &rui8Ret) const =0zeus::IZVariant [pure virtual]
getVariantName(IString &rstrName) const =0zeus::IZVariant [pure virtual]
release() const =0zeus::IZUnknown [pure virtual]
serialize(IByteArray &raStream) const =0zeus::ISerializable [pure virtual]
setByteArray(const IByteArray &raVal)=0zeus::IZVariant [pure virtual]
setFloat32(Float32 f32Val)=0zeus::IZVariant [pure virtual]
setFloat64(Float64 f64Val)=0zeus::IZVariant [pure virtual]
setInt16(Int16 i16Val)=0zeus::IZVariant [pure virtual]
setInt32(Int32 i32Val)=0zeus::IZVariant [pure virtual]
setInt64(Int64 i64Val)=0zeus::IZVariant [pure virtual]
setInt8(Int8 i8Val)=0zeus::IZVariant [pure virtual]
setObject(const ISerializable &rVal)=0zeus::IZVariant [pure virtual]
setObjectList(const ISerializableList &rVal)=0zeus::IZVariant [pure virtual]
setRetval(Retval retVal)=0zeus::IZVariant [pure virtual]
setString(const IString &rstrVal)=0zeus::IZVariant [pure virtual]
setTimeval(Timeval tmVal)=0zeus::IZVariant [pure virtual]
setUint16(Uint16 ui16Val)=0zeus::IZVariant [pure virtual]
setUint32(Uint32 ui32Val)=0zeus::IZVariant [pure virtual]
setUint64(Uint64 ui64Val)=0zeus::IZVariant [pure virtual]
setUint8(Uint8 ui8Val)=0zeus::IZVariant [pure virtual]
setVariantName(const IString &rstrName)=0zeus::IZVariant [pure virtual]
toFloat(Float fDefault=0) const =0zeus::IZVariant [pure virtual]
toInt(Int iDefault=0) const =0zeus::IZVariant [pure virtual]
toString(IString &rstrValue) const =0zeus::IZVariant [pure virtual]
toUint(Uint uiDefault=0) const =0zeus::IZVariant [pure virtual]
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ines


Written by Benjamin Hadorn http://www.xatlantis.ch.
Last change made on Sun Jan 22 2012 15:28:38